Add notebook 09-attestation-buildup analyzing how validator attestations
accumulate over time. For each slot, attestations can be included in blocks
up to 32 slots later. This analysis shows:

- Attestation inclusion CDF heatmaps by slot and epoch
- Correlation with blob count and block size
- Block propagation timing effects on attestation inclusion
- Time series trends of network health

Why are we limiting the inclusion time to only 32 slots?

Since EIP-7045, attestations for the first block in epoch N would have until the end of epoch N+1 to be included, meaning that the max inclusion distance is 63 slots.
